Prep Time: 30 Minutes Cook Time: 30 Minutes |
Ready In: 60 Minutes Servings: 8 |
|
Fresh sweet potatoes Mom grew disappeared fast at our family table when she served them with this easy, flavorful glaze. She still makes them this way, and now they've become favorites with her grandchildren as well! Rosemary Pryor, Pasadena, Maryland Ingredients:
2 pounds sweet potatoes or 2 cans (15-3/4 ounces each) sweet potatoes, drained |
1/4 cup butter, cubed |
1/4 cup maple syrup |
1/4 cup packed brown sugar |
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on |
Directions:
1. If using fresh sweet potatoes, place in a large saucepan or Dutch oven; cover with water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and cook 25-40 minutes or until tender. Drain; cool slightly and peel. Cut into chunks. 2. Preheat oven to 350°. Place sweet potatoes in a 2-qt. baking dish. In a small saucepan, combine butter, syrup, brown sugar and cinnamon; bring to a boil, stirring constantly. Pour over potatoes. 3. Bake, uncovered, 30-40 minutes or until heated through. Yield: 8 servings. |
